Roald Dahl (1916-1990), an illustrious British author known for his captivating fantasy, mystery, and horror novels and stories, penned down some of the greatest works of the 20th century. Ranging from his unforgettable children’s tales to intriguing stories for adults, Dahl’s works drew readers from all walks of life. Dahl, who was of Norwegian descent, was born in Wales and found his way into the Royal Air Force, where he became a flying ace.
After surviving a plane crash and enduring severe headaches, Dahl encountered the renowned author C.S. Forester. Forester was so touched by Dahl’s war stories that he decided to publish them exactly as told. At this point, Dahl’s journey as a children’s author truly began, leading him to create iconic tales like Charlie and the Chocolate Factory, Matilda, James and the Giant Peach, and The BFG, among others. His distinct writing style and vivid imagination cemented his place as one of the most influential children’s authors of his era.

Dahl’s debut into the world of published novels came in 1943 with the children’s book The Gremlins. Drawing from the folklore of the Royal Air Force, the story suggests that mysterious beings called gremlins were to blame for any technical issues encountered with their planes.
